Nathalie Abi-Ezzi’s A GIRL MADE OF DUST shortlisted for the Authors’ Club Best First Novel Award 2008

February 9, 2009

A GIRL MADE OF DUST, Nathalie Abi-Ezzi's first novel, has been shortlisted for the Author's Club Best First Novel Award 2008, along with novelists like Poppy Adams, Daniel Clay and Ross Raisin. The winners will be announced at the ceremony at the end of March 2009.

 

Published in the UK by Fourth Estate, with the paperback due out from Harper Perennial on 2 April, A GIRL MADE OF DUST has also been sold in several countries around the world, including to Random in Canada and Grove Atlantic in the US. Translation rights are sold in Germany, Holland, Italy, Lithuania and Spain.
